Here is a list of topics covered in this video:
1. Introduction to IR Spectroscopy
2. Absorption of IR energy - Molecular Vibrations - Stretching, Compression, & Bending
3. Concept of Transmittance and Absorbance
4. Relationship Between Wavelength, Wavenumber cm^-1, Frequency, and Energy
5. Signal Characteristics Shape: Broad vs Sharp
6. Signal Intensity: Weak, Medium, or Strong
7. The effect of hydrogen bonding and bond polarity on signal shape and intensity
8. Diagnostic / Functional Group Region vs Fingerprint Region
9. The Relationship Between The Mass of the Atom and The Wavenumber
10. Relationship Between Bond Strength and Wavenumber
11. The Effect of Conjugation on IR Frequency Absorption
12. IR Spectrum For Alkanes, Alkenes, & Alkynes
13. IR Spectrum of an Internal Alkyne vs a Terminal Alkyne
14. IR Active vs IR Inactive Compounds - Symmetrical & Assymetrical Bonds
15. Electric Field, Force, & Dipole Moments - IR Bond Stretch vs Compression
16. IR Spectrum of a Carboxylic Acid vs an Alcohol - OH Stretch
17. IR Spectrum of Aldehydes & Ketones: C=O Carbonyl Stretch @ 1700 cm^-1
18. IR Graph of Esters and Ethers: C-O Stretch @ 1000 to 1300. Sp2 vs Sp3 Hybridized Carbon
19. IR Graph of Primary and Secondary Amines: Single vs Double Peak at 3300 & 3400 cm^-1
Symmetric and Assymetric Stretching of NH2 Hydrogen Atoms.
20. IR Spectrum of Amides & Nitriles
21. Carbonyl C=O Stretch - Resonance Electron Donating Groups vs Inductive Electron Withdrawing Groups
22. IR Spectrum of Aromatic Benzene Ring Derivatives C=C & =CH Stretch
